Wood shingle repair services involve assessing and fixing issues with existing wooden roofing shingles to restore their appearance and functionality. Over time, exposure to weather elements such as rain, wind, and sunlight can cause shingles to crack, split, or become loose. Repair work typically includes replacing damaged shingles, re-nailing loose ones, and sealing gaps to prevent water intrusion. Proper repair helps maintain the roof’s integrity, preventing further deterioration and avoiding more costly repairs or replacements down the line.
This service addresses common problems like rotting, warping, or splitting shingles that compromise the roof’s ability to protect the home. It also helps resolve issues caused by pests or mold growth, which can weaken the wood and lead to leaks. Repairing wood shingles promptly can prevent water from seeping into the underlying roof structure, reducing the risk of interior damage, mold, and structural issues. Regular repairs can extend the lifespan of a wood shingle roof and keep it looking attractive for years.

The overview below groups typical Wood Shingles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Millington, TN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- minor repairs such as replacing a few damaged shingles typ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ine patch j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and accessibility. Local contractors often handle these quicker, lower-cost projects efficiently.
Partial Roof Repairs - fixing or replacing larger sections of shingles can range from $600 to $2,000. Projects in this range are common for moderate damage or localized issues, with costs varying based on roof size and shingle type. Larger or more complex partial repairs may push beyond this range.
Full Roof Re-shingling - replacing the entire roof with new wood shingles generally costs between $10,000 and $20,000. Many homes fall into this mid-to-high range, though larger or more intricate roofs can increase costs significantly. Local service providers can help assess the scope and price for full replacements.
Complete Roof Replacement - a full roof overhaul, including removal and installation of new shingles, can exceed $20,000 and reach $30,000+ for larger or high-end projects. These are less common but necessary for extensive damage or aging roofs, with costs depending on roof size and material choices.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of damage can wood shingle repair address? Local contractors can fix issues such as cracked, split, or rotting shingles, as well as areas affected by weather or pests.
How do professionals typically repair wood shingles? They often replace damaged shingles, reinforce existing ones, and ensure proper sealing to prevent future issues.
Are repairs to wood shingles a good way to extend their lifespan? Yes, timely repairs can help maintain the integrity of wood shingles and delay the need for full replacement.
What signs indicate that wood shingles need repair? Visible cracks, missing shingles, water stains, or signs of rot are common indicators that repair services may be needed.
Can local contractors match the appearance of existing wood shingles during repairs? Skilled service providers can often match the style and finish to blend repairs seamlessly with existing shingles.
